
Complete cost breakdown and ownership estimate
Prices vary based on lineage, breeder reputation, location, and whether the Doberman Pinscher is pet-quality or show-quality. Adopting from a rescue or shelter typically costs $50–$500 and gives a Doberman Pinscher a second chance at a loving home.
| Expense | Estimated Range |
|---|---|
| Food & treats | $49–$63/mo |
| Veterinary care (wellness) | $28–$42/mo |
| Grooming | $14–$21/mo |
| Pet insurance | $30–$70/mo |
| Toys, supplies & misc | $11–$17/mo |
| Total monthly estimate | ~$140/mo |
Purchase
$1,000–$3,000
Initial setup
$300–$800
crate, bed, bowls, collar, leash
12 months care
~$1,680
This estimate includes routine food, veterinary wellness visits, grooming, insurance, and supplies — but does not include emergency veterinary care, boarding, or specialized training. Actual costs vary by location, lifestyle choices, and your Doberman Pinscher's individual health needs.

The Doberman Pinscher is a medium to large-sized working dog with a noble, sleek appearance and a compact, muscular build. Known for their intelligence, loyalty, and alert nature, they make excellent guardians and companion dogs when properly trained and socialized.
